THE EFFECT OF THE APPLICATION OF PICTURE AND PICTURE LEARNING MODEL ON THE WRITING SKILLS OF TSANAWIYAH MADRASAH STUDENTS

This study aims to facilitate and attract students' interest in learning writing skills. The research method used is experimental quantitative research. The data collection techniques used by researchers are tests, interviews, observations, documentation. The sampling technique in this study is a simple random sampling technique. The sample in this study amounted to 40 students, namely class A experimental class totaling 20 students and class B control class totaling 20 students.  Based on the results of the study shows that the application of the picture and picture learning model affects the maharatul kitabah, this can be proven by the t-test (independent t test) obtained sig value results. (2-tailed) 0.000 <.05. So Ha was accepted and Ho was rejected. This means that the picture and picture learning model affects the writing skills of grade VIII students at MTS Bustanul Ulum, Central Lampung. In the results of data analysis regarding students' writing skills in learning obtained an average score before being given treatment (pretest) experimental class was 56.75. Meanwhile, after being given treatment (posttest) the experimental class was 79.75. The pretest score in the control class was 51.75 while the posttest score in the control class was 68.5. So it can be concluded that classes that are treated with the picture and picture learning model have a higher average score compared to the scores of students who do not use the picture and picture learning model.
